Training at friendly Gyms and challenging rival Gyms earns you XP, but it fluctuates. The closer your Pokemon's CP is to your opponent's and the more Pokemon you defeat, the more XP you'll earn. If you desire to optimize the XP you gain from combating, use a Pokemon with a CP score that matches, or are less than, the competitions. Alternatively, find a friendly gym with some Pokemon you can readily beat, and repeatedly train - or even add one of your lower level Pokemon that another in your team can readily overcome.

With a Lucky Egg activated, each evolved Pokemon will allow you 1,000 XP! If you're evolving a Pokemon into one you haven't caught before, you'll get 2,000 XP! Catching a Pokemon is only going to net you 200 XP, but if you catch a new Pokemon, you'll get 1,200 XP.

The first item to consider when desiring to amount is the Lucky Egg. When activated, this piece will double all XP earned for half an hour! Combine this with Incense or a Tempt Module and you'll be raking in XP just by catching lots of Pokemon. Be sure you've stocked up on Poke Balls before doing this, either at PokeStops or the Shop! Strategy to evolve lots of Pokemon and investigate new places saturated with PokeStops before activating a Lucky Egg to ensure you'll take advantage of it!
